Heading north there were some clouds but by Buellton there was mostly sun. However, by San Luis Obispo the Clouds were more of a regular feature by about Salinas it was misting because I guess another storm is coming in for this weekend. However, all the way to this point the Green grasses and Spring wildflower bloom was happening. However, it would be hard to pinpoint when the bloom between Santa Barbara and San Francisco will peak because at least one rain and snow storm is coming through every week for awhile now. I heard that it's so cold that the Santa Lucia Mountains above Big Sur are expecting snow there too which is really unusual for April of Any year.
